What to Look for in an Automatic Vacuum Cleaner: Key Features and Considerations

Picking the ideal automatic vacuum involves thinking about a number of elements to ensure it effectively meets your cleaning requirements and incorporates seamlessly into your way of life. Here are some vital elements to examine before purchasing:

Navigation System: A robot vacuum's navigation system is its brain, determining how efficiently and successfully it cleans your floors. Various types of navigation exist:

  • Random/Bounce Navigation: Older and typically affordable models use this system. They move arbitrarily, bouncing off challenges up until the battery is low. While they ultimately cover the location, their cleaning patterns are less effective and can miss out on spots.
  • Systematic Navigation (Row-by-Row): These vacuums clean in straight lines, systematically covering an area. They are more effective than random navigation and offer much better protection.
  • L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) Navigation: Utilizing lasers, LiDAR creates comprehensive maps of your home. This permits for highly effective and systematic cleaning, smart path preparation, and features like room-specific cleaning and virtual boundaries.
  • Camera-Based S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ping) Navigation: These vacuums utilize video cameras to aesthetically map their environments. They use comparable smart functions to LiDAR, but their efficiency can be impacted by lighting conditions.
  • Suction Power: The strength of a robot vacuum's suction identifies its capability to choose up dirt, dust, debris, and pet hair from different floor types. Greater suction power is normally better, especially for carpets and homes with animals. Look for specs like Pascal (Pa) score to compare suction levels between designs.
  • Battery Life and Coverage Area: Battery life dictates how long a robot vacuum can run on a single charge. Consider the size of your home and select a model with adequate battery life to cover your cleaning area. Some advanced models include automatic charging and resume, going back to the charging dock when low and after that resuming cleaning where they ended.

Functions and Functionality: Beyond standard vacuuming, lots of robot vacuums use additional functions that improve their benefit and cleaning capabilities:

  • Mopping Functionality: Some hybrid models combine vacuuming and mopping, providing a 2-in-1 cleaning solution. These may consist of different water tanks and mopping pads.
  • Self-Emptying Dustbins: Premium designs include self-emptying bases. The robot vacuum automatically clears its dustbin into a larger bin in the base, minimizing the frequency of manual emptying.
  • App Control and Smart Home Integration: Wi-Fi connection allows control via smartphone apps. Functions may include scheduling cleanings, adjusting suction levels, viewing cleaning maps, setting virtual limits, and incorporating with voice assistants like Alexa or Google Assistant.
  • Floor Type Detection: Smart vacuums can discover various floor types (wood, carpet, rugs) and adjust suction power immediately for optimal cleaning.
  • Challenge Avoidance and Object Recognition: Advanced sensors and AI algorithms help robot vacuums navigate around furnishings, pet bowls, and even recognize and avoid smaller things like shoes or cables, preventing them from getting stuck or dragging products around.
  • Upkeep and Durability: Consider the ease of upkeep, such as clearing the dustbin, cleaning brushes, and replacing filters. Try to find designs with quickly available components and available replacement parts. Check out evaluations concerning the vacuum's toughness and reliability.
  • Cost and Value: Robot vacuums vary in cost from affordable to premium. Identify your budget plan and balance functions and performance with expense. Consider the long-term worth of a robot vacuum in terms of time saved and benefit.

Top Automatic Vacuum Cleaners: Leading Models in the Market

With a wide range of choices available, determining the really "best" automatic vacuum is subjective and depends upon private requirements and concerns. Nevertheless, numerous designs consistently rank high in evaluations and provide extraordinary efficiency and functions. Here are a couple of notable examples:

iRobot Roomba j7+: Renowned for its smart navigation and object acknowledgment, the Roomba j7+ is a leading competitor. Its PrecisionVision Navigation identifies barriers and learns to avoid them, decreasing disturbances. The "+" represents the Clean Base automatic dirt disposal, making upkeep much more hands-off. It's app-controlled, incorporates with smart homes, and provides outstanding cleaning performance, specifically for pet hair.

  • Pros: Exceptional barrier avoidance, self-emptying base, smart mapping and features, strong cleaning efficiency.
  • Cons: Higher cost point, dust bags for the Clean Base need replacing.
  • Best for: Homes with animals and clutter, users prioritizing smart features and benefit.

Eufy RoboVac X8 Hybrid: Offering a balance of efficiency and value, the Eufy RoboVac X8 Hybrid delivers strong suction with its twin-turbine system. It features iPath Laser Navigation for effective mapping and navigation, and includes a mopping function for hard floorings. App control, virtual limits, and zone cleaning contribute to its versatility.

  • Pros: Powerful suction, LiDAR navigation at a competitive price, mopping function, app control.
  • Cons: Dustbin requires manual emptying, mopping is standard compared to dedicated mopping robotics.
  • Best for: Users seeking powerful cleaning and smart navigation without the premium rate tag, those with combined floor types.

Shark IQ Robot Self-Empty XL R101AE: The Shark IQ Robot line uses strong efficiency at a more accessible rate point, particularly the Self-Empty XL model. It includes row-by-row cleaning, self-emptying base, and app control with scheduling and zone cleaning. It navigates efficiently and offers strong suction for daily cleaning.

  • Pros: Self-emptying dustbin, excellent cleaning performance for the cost, row-by-row navigation, app control.
  • Cons: Navigation not as advanced as LiDAR or camera-based systems, can battle with intricate designs.
  • Best for: Users trying to find a self-emptying robot vacuum at a mid-range cost, effective for general home cleaning.

Roborock S7 MaxV Ultra: Representing the high-end of robot vacuum innovation, the Roborock S7 MaxV Ultra is a powerhouse of cleaning and automation. It boasts LiDAR navigation, reactive obstacle avoidance, effective suction, and a comprehensive docking station that not just self-empties but also washes and dries the mop pad and refills the water tank.

  • Pros: Ultimate automation with self-emptying, mop washing, and water refilling, advanced obstacle avoidance, LiDAR navigation, powerful suction, sonic mopping.
  • Cons: Very high cost, complex setup may be daunting for some users.
  • Best for: Tech lovers and users seeking the most automated and feature-rich cleaning experience, those with large homes and demanding cleaning needs.

Note: This is not an extensive list, and new models are constantly being launched. It is constantly advised to research study current evaluations and compare specifications based upon your particular needs and spending plan.

Tips for Maximizing Your Robot Vacuum's Performance

To ensure your automatic vacuum operates efficiently and lasts longer, follow these basic ideas:

  • Regular Maintenance: Empty the dustbin routinely, tidy brushes and rollers of hair and debris, and change filters as suggested by the producer to preserve optimum suction and efficiency.
  • Prepare the Floor: Before each cleaning cycle, remove clutter like cables, small toys, and loose items that could obstruct the robot vacuum or get tangled in its brushes.
  • Make Use Of Virtual Boundaries and No-Go Zones: Use virtual limits or physical limit strips (if supported) to avoid the robot vacuum from going into locations you do not want cleaned up or getting stuck in bothersome areas.
  • Try out Scheduling: Optimize your cleaning schedule based upon your lifestyle and home traffic patterns. Consider scheduling cleanings when you are out of your home to minimize disturbance.
  • Keep Software Updated: For smart robot vacuums, ensure you keep the firmware and app upgraded to benefit from the newest features, enhancements, and bug repairs.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s) about Automatic Vacuum Cleaners

  • How typically should I run my robot vacuum? For optimal cleanliness, running your robot vacuum day-to-day or every other day is suggested, specifically in families with pets or high foot traffic.
  • Can robot vacuums handle pet hair? Yes, numerous robot vacuums are particularly created for pet hair with features like tangle-free brushes and strong suction. Models specifically marketed for pet owners typically carry out best.
  • Do robot vacuums deal with carpets? Yes, most robot vacuums work on carpets and hard floorings. The effectiveness on carpets can vary depending on the suction power and brush type. Higher-end designs with more powerful suction and specialized brushes perform better on carpets.
  • How long do robot vacuums last? The lifespan of a robot vacuum can differ depending on the brand name, model, use, and upkeep. Generally, you can expect a properly maintained robot vacuum to last for 3-5 years, or even longer.
  • Are robot vacuums worth the money? For many individuals, the benefit, time cost savings, and constant cleaning provided by robot vacuums make them a beneficial investment. Consider your way of life, cleaning requirements, and spending plan to identify if a robot vacuum is the ideal option for you.
